Transaction 2ddb78603c03aea177a8bd9064d953ca6361d1f2b80757f140b38c5ba51ef695
1 Input
1 Output
-
2ddb78603c03aea177a8bd9064d953ca6361d1f2b80757f140b38c5ba51ef695:0
- value
- 788668
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 431573d48e63e6c9df96269404e03be14387db2e OP_EQUALVERIFY OP_CHECKSIG
- address
- 177hyPxbKaQ3sdQdAESWoyu346DHnWwYN5